This two-volume set CCIS 2264 and CCIS 2265 constitutes the refereed proceedings of the 6th International Conference on Blockchain and Trustworthy Systems, BlockSys 2024, held in Hangzhou, China, during July 12-14, 2024.
The 34 full papers presented in these two volumes were carefully reviewed and selected from 74 submissions. The papers are organized in the following topical sections:
Part I: Blockchain and Data Mining; Data Security and Anomaly Detection; Blockchain Performance Optimization.
Part II: Frontier Technology Integration; Trustworthy System and Cryptocurrencies; Blockchain Applications.

The file format PDF always displays a book page identically on any hardware. This makes PDF suitable for complex layouts such as those used in textbooks and reference books (images, tables, columns, footnotes). Unfortunately, on the small screens of e-readers or smartphones, PDFs are rather annoying, requiring too much scrolling.
This eBook uses Watermark-DRM, a „soft” copy protection. This means that there are no technical restrictions to prevent illegal distribution. However, there is a personalised watermark embedded in the eBook that can be used to identify the purchaser of the eBook in the event of misuse and to provide evidence for legal purposes.
